LI Ducks' Trevor Bauer gets into nasty car crash in Arizona
Key Points:
- Former Cy Young winner Trevor Bauer was involved in a car crash in Arizona but was not injured and was not at fault, according to TMZ and the Long Island Ducks.
- Bauer was in Arizona receiving treatment for back spasms that have placed him on the injured list, with no set timetable for his return to play.
- This season, Bauer has posted a 4-1 record, a seven-inning no-hitter, and a 2.43 ERA for the Long Island Ducks, an independent league team.
- Bauer has been attempting an MLB comeback after a 2021 suspension related to domestic violence and sexual assault policy violations, though he has denied the allegations and has not been criminally charged.
- Despite his strong performance, Bauer claims he is blackballed from MLB and has expressed frustration over his inability to return, stating he would even play for no salary.
